Question

Regarding wearable technology, which of the following tasks is/are accomplished by wearable devices?

A. Providing more security compared to other computing devices

B. Sharing of a wearable device's Internet connection with other connected computers

C. Assisting hearing impaired persons

Choose the correct answer from the options given below:

The correct answer is

C only

Understanding Wearable Technology Tasks

Wearable technology encompasses electronic devices that are worn on the body, either as accessories or as part of clothing. These devices perform a variety of tasks, from tracking fitness data to providing notifications and communication. Let's analyze the statements provided regarding the tasks accomplished by wearable devices.

Analyzing Statement A: Wearable Technology Security

Statement A suggests that wearable devices provide more security compared to other computing devices. This is generally not true. Wearable devices often have limited processing power and storage, which can restrict the implementation of robust security features compared to smartphones or laptops. Furthermore, their constant connectivity and collection of personal data can introduce privacy and security risks if not properly protected. Therefore, statement A is incorrect.

Analyzing Statement B: Sharing Internet Connection

Statement B claims that wearable devices share their Internet connection with other connected computers. While some standalone smartwatches may have cellular connectivity, their primary function is not to act as mobile hotspots for other devices like computers. This functionality is typically handled by smartphones. Wearables usually connect to the internet via a paired smartphone or Wi-Fi, and they consume data rather than share it extensively with other computers. Therefore, statement B is incorrect.

Analyzing Statement C: Assisting Hearing Impaired Persons

Statement C posits that wearable devices assist hearing impaired persons. This is a valid application of wearable technology. Smartwatches, for example, can provide discreet, tactile notifications (vibrations) for incoming calls, messages, or alarms, which can be very helpful for individuals who cannot hear audio alerts. Additionally, specialized wearable devices designed as advanced hearing aids can connect wirelessly to phones and other devices, improving sound perception and offering connectivity features. Therefore, statement C is correct.

Concluding Which Tasks are Accomplished by Wearable Devices

Based on the analysis of each statement:

  • Statement A (Providing more security): Incorrect.
  • Statement B (Sharing Internet connection): Incorrect.
  • Statement C (Assisting hearing impaired persons): Correct.

Only statement C describes a task that is genuinely accomplished by wearable devices, either through general accessibility features or specific assistive technology devices that fall under the wearable category.

Additional Information on Wearable Technology

Wearable technology covers a wide range of devices with diverse functions. Some common examples include:

  • Smartwatches: Display notifications, track fitness, make calls, provide navigation.
  • Fitness Trackers: Monitor steps, heart rate, sleep patterns, calories burned.
  • Smart Glasses: Display information overlay, augmented reality, photography.
  • Wearable Medical Devices: Continuous glucose monitors, ECG monitors, blood pressure monitors.
  • Smart Clothing: Garments with integrated sensors for tracking activity or health.

These devices are designed for convenience, data collection, communication, and sometimes for specific assistive or medical purposes. While they are increasingly integrated into our lives, understanding their capabilities and limitations, including security aspects, is important.
